Air frying cuts total added fat compared to deep frying since you only need a light oil mist for browning. The result is a crisp, flavorful crust without starches, helping you hit your macros while keeping glycemic load low. Cooking tips: toss the pork evenly with oil and spices, then finish with a fine dusting of Parmesan for extra crisp. Check doneness using a [digital meat thermometer](https://rocktopgear.com/amazon) and cook pork to 145 degrees Fahrenheit, then rest 3 minutes for safe and juicy results.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days and re crisp in the air fryer at 375 degrees Fahrenheit for 3 to 4 minutes. The same spice blend also works on cubes of chicken if you are planning keto air fryer chicken breasts for another day. FAQ: - **Does air frying reduce the fat content compared to deep frying?** Yes. This recipe uses about 1 tablespoon of oil for the whole batch, which is significantly less than deep frying, yet still yields crisp edges. - **What size air fryer do I need for this recipe?** A 5.8 qt basket fits one pound of bites in a single layer. An 8 qt model handles 1.5 to 2 pounds, ideal for a diabetic friendly 8 qt air fryer setup. - **Can I use parchment paper or aluminum foil in the air fryer?** Use perforated parchment or foil with holes, placed under the pork and weighted by the food to prevent lift up.
